Notes — ThumbForge queue review, Tuesday sync. We talked through the resize worker: jobs are now signed before enqueue, and the Pixelmoor bucket got scoped write-only creds. Still open: retry storms when a corrupt upload loops — capped at five attempts for now. Security review of the signing flow is next. Action owner is named below.

account owner for tawef-yadug: Jorius Normir Silath

Subject: GrowCell controller — sensor drift fix shipping tonight

Hi all — quick note for folks new to the team. The GrowCell greenhouse controller has been reporting humidity values that drift upward about 2% per week due to a calibration bug in the polling loop. Tonight's release applies a rolling recalibration every six hours and logs corrections so we can verify the fix in the Fernway test greenhouse. No action needed on your end; rollout is automatic. For anyone auditing the deployment, the trace token for this release is below.

session token of yajof-bagef = htk4_937d

## Tuning

The Quillbase ORM rewrite kept the old layer's batching behavior, so nothing here changes query semantics — but a few limits matter for your threat model. Statement caching is bounded, parameterization is enforced everywhere, and the retry budget caps how long a poisoned connection can linger. Crank these up and you widen the window for stale-credential reuse, so tread carefully. Current values are as follows.

constants for bagag-fawip:
BUDGETS = {
    "wenius": 400,
    "brieth": 224,
    "rusath": 783,
    "eliys": 187,
    "aldax": 737,
    "ralion": 818,
    "istius": 153,
}

## Alert: StatRelay Sidecar Flush Lag

This alert fires when the StatRelay metrics-aggregation sidecar falls more than 120 seconds behind on flushing buffered samples to the Coalmine backend. Plugin-emitted counters are buffered in-process, so sustained lag usually means a plugin is emitting unbounded label cardinality or blocking the flush thread. Check your plugin's metric registration against the published cardinality limits before escalating. If the lag persists after your plugin is ruled out, contact the telemetry team.

escalation mailbox, bagug-fahof: novdor.wendor.jormir@norvalabs.example